SQL: Unterschied zwischen den Versionen
Aus FI-Wiki
| (Eine dazwischenliegende Version desselben Benutzers wird nicht angezeigt) | |||
| Zeile 7: | Zeile 7: | ||
SQL umfasst mehrere Teilbereiche: | SQL umfasst mehrere Teilbereiche: | ||
* '''[[DDL SQL|DDL]] (Data Definition Language)''' – Datenbankobjekte erstellen und verändern | * '''[[DDL-SQL|DDL]] (Data Definition Language)''' – Datenbankobjekte erstellen und verändern | ||
z. B. CREATE, ALTER, DROP | z. B. CREATE, ALTER, DROP | ||
* '''DML (Data Manipulation Language)''' – Daten einfügen, ändern oder löschen | * '''[[DML-SQL|DML]] (Data Manipulation Language)''' – Daten einfügen, ändern oder löschen | ||
z. B. INSERT, UPDATE, DELETE | z. B. INSERT, UPDATE, DELETE | ||
* '''DQL (Data Query Language)''' – Daten abfragen | * '''[[DQL-SQL|DQL]] (Data Query Language)''' – Daten abfragen | ||
z. B. SELECT | z. B. SELECT | ||
* '''DCL (Data Control Language)''' – Zugriffsrechte vergeben oder entziehen | * '''[[DCL-SQL|DCL]] (Data Control Language)''' – Zugriffsrechte vergeben oder entziehen | ||
z. B. GRANT, REVOKE | z. B. GRANT, REVOKE | ||
| Zeile 28: | Zeile 28: | ||
* standardisierte, weit verbreitete Sprache | * standardisierte, weit verbreitete Sprache | ||
* unabhängig vom Datenbanksystem | * unabhängig vom Datenbanksystem | ||
* klar verständliche Befehle | |||
* klar verständliche Befehle | |||
=== Kurzmerksatz === | === Kurzmerksatz === | ||
'''SQL ist die Standardsprache, um Datenbanken zu erstellen, Daten zu bearbeiten und Informationen abzufragen.''' | '''SQL ist die Standardsprache, um Datenbanken zu erstellen, Daten zu bearbeiten und Informationen abzufragen.''' | ||
Aktuelle Version vom 30. November 2025, 10:51 Uhr
SQL
SQL (Structured Query Language) ist die Standardsprache zur Arbeit mit relationalen Datenbanken. Mit SQL können Datenbanken erstellt, verändert und abgefragt werden. Die Sprache ist leicht verständlich, da sie aus klaren, englischsprachigen Befehlen besteht.
Aufgabenbereiche von SQL
SQL umfasst mehrere Teilbereiche:
- DDL (Data Definition Language) – Datenbankobjekte erstellen und verändern
z. B. CREATE, ALTER, DROP
- DML (Data Manipulation Language) – Daten einfügen, ändern oder löschen
z. B. INSERT, UPDATE, DELETE
- DQL (Data Query Language) – Daten abfragen
z. B. SELECT
- DCL (Data Control Language) – Zugriffsrechte vergeben oder entziehen
z. B. GRANT, REVOKE
Beispiel für eine einfache SQL-Abfrage
SELECT name, ort
FROM kunden
WHERE ort = 'Berlin';
Diese Anfrage gibt alle Kunden zurück, die in Berlin wohnen.
Vorteile von SQL
- standardisierte, weit verbreitete Sprache
- unabhängig vom Datenbanksystem
- klar verständliche Befehle
Kurzmerksatz
SQL ist die Standardsprache, um Datenbanken zu erstellen, Daten zu bearbeiten und Informationen abzufragen.
